Is it always necessary to perform an axillary lymph node dissection on patients undergoing neoadjuvant therapy? Outcomes of a retrospective study.
CONCLUSIONS: The possibility to detect patients with a lower risk of nodal disease before surgery may reduce the rate of false negative results of sentinel lymph node biopsy in patients receiving a neoadjuvant therapy.
